硬岩巷道钻装锚一体机研究与应用 被引量:4

Study and Application of Drilling,Loading and Bolting Integrated MachineApplied to Mine Hard Rock Roadway

摘要 为解决硬岩巷道施工机械化程度低、施工效率不高、现有装备不能满足岩巷快速施工的问题,根据部分现有施工巷道断面形状、断面参数以及锚杆、锚索长度等主要参数,结合钻爆法施工速度影响因素分析,提出了硬岩巷道钻装锚一体机的研制方向,确定了设备研制方案及具体参数要求;通过联合研发的形式,研制出了硬岩巷道钻装锚一体机,并进行了现场应用。五阳煤矿82采区2号回风大巷采用钻装锚一体机及相配套的工艺施工后,连续3个月,每月进尺均超过90 m,施工效率比以往提高50%,施工队用工人数减少30%以上。研究表明:随着操作熟练程度的提高及后配套系统的完善,硬岩掘进施工采用钻装锚一体机,能够有效降低人工成本,提高施工效率,改善作业环境,是目前解决硬岩巷道快速高效安全施工的主要方法之一。 In order to solve a low mechanization and low construction efficiency in the mine hard rock roadway construction as well as the available equipment not meet the requirement of the rapid construction in the hard rock roadway,according to the cross section type and the cross section parameters of the partial available construction roadway as well as the bolt and anchor length and main parameters,in combination with the analysis on the factors effected to the construction speed with the drilling and blasting method,a research and development orientation of the drilling,loading and bolting integrated machine was provided for the mine hard rock roadway and the equipment research and development plan and the certain parameter requirements were set up.With a type of a united research and development,the drilling,loading and bolting integrated machine for the mine hard rock roadway was developed and had a site application.After the construction with the drilling,loading and bolting integrated machine and the related matched technology applied to No.2 air return roadway in No.82 mining block of Wuyang Mine,the construction operation was kept continuously for 3 months.The each month footage all was over 90 m,the construction efficiency was increased by 50% in comparison with previous and the worker number of the construction team was reduced by over 30%.The study showed that with the operation proficiency increased and the back-up system improved,the drilling,loading and bolting integrated machine applied to the roadway heading in the hard rock could efficiently reduce the labor cost,could increase the construction efficiency and could improve the operation environment as well as could be one of the main methods to solve the rapid,high efficient and safety construction of the mine hard rock roadway.
